PLANT DESCRIPTION

Sidi Krir power project consists of two 250 MW combustion turbine generators (CTGs) where exhaust gasses are fed to unfired heat recovery steam generator (HRSG) and recovered to supply Steam to a single reheat, condensing Steam Turbine Generator (STG).

The estimated 750 MW net output and fed to the National grid via a 500 kV, GIS switchyard. The plant utilizes a once through cooling system with water feed from Mediterranean Sea.
